TINT (ProShares Smart Materials ETF) has a solid but not outstanding overall rating, reflecting a mix of strong core holdings and some notable risks. High-quality names like Merck, Applied Materials, and Corning support the fund with robust financial performance, positive earnings outlooks, and strategic growth initiatives, though some face overvaluation concerns. The rating is held back by several holdings with weaker technical trends, high debt or valuation risks, and challenges in revenue growth and cash flow, making sector and company-specific execution risks an important consideration.

ProShares Smart Materials ETF (TINT) tracks the Solactive Smart Materials Index, focusing on companies that develop advanced, high-tech materials used in areas like electronics, healthcare, and aerospace. It holds well-known names such as Corning and Applied Materials, along with other innovators in coatings, composites, and specialty chemicals. An investor might consider TINT to get diversified exposure to the potential growth of new materials that support modern technologies and infrastructure. However, this ETF is concentrated in the materials and technology sectors, so its price can be more volatile and can go up and down sharply with changes in those industries.
How much will it cost me?This ETF has an annual expense ratio of 0.58%, which means you’ll pay about $5.80 per year for every $1,000 you invest. That’s higher than the average low-cost index ETF because this fund tracks a specialized smart materials index and is more narrowly focused than broad, plain-vanilla market ETFs.
What would affect this ETF?This ETF could benefit if global manufacturing, construction, and technology spending grow, since many of its materials and tech holdings, like Corning and Applied Materials, are tied to demand for advanced products in electronics, aerospace, and healthcare. On the downside, it may be hurt by higher interest rates, slower global growth, or stricter environmental rules on chemicals and industrial production, which can raise costs and reduce profits for materials and industrial companies around the world.
